Mysql 使用触发器创建分区

Mysql 使用触发器创建分区,mysql,partitioning,mysql-5.6,Mysql,Partitioning,Mysql 5.6,在Mysql 5.6中,是否可以使用触发器自动化现有表的新分区创建过程 我有两个表表A和表B。我需要根据列ID创建列表分区表B。如果在表A中插入了新列,我需要使用新ID在表B中自动创建分区 **Table A Table B ID ID 1 1 2 2 3** 现在,我需要自动化为表B中的Id值3创建分区的过程,以便在表B中插入记录时不会引发错误。通常,触发器中不允许使

在Mysql 5.6中,是否可以使用触发器自动化现有表的新分区创建过程

我有两个表表A和表B。我需要根据列ID创建列表分区表B。如果在表A中插入了新列,我需要使用新ID在表B中自动创建分区

**Table A            Table B
ID                 ID 
1                  1
2                  2
3** 

现在,我需要自动化为表B中的Id值3创建分区的过程,以便在表B中插入记录时不会引发错误。

通常,触发器中不允许使用DDL语句。为什么要按列表创建
?你有没有测试表明它比不分区更快或更好?@Rick James没有,我还没有测试,我想测试列表分区和不分区的性能